Jill Katz has excavated at several sites in Israel, including Ashkelon, Tel Haror/Gerar, Tell es-Safi/Gath, and most recently at Jerusalem's Ophel. Her research interests focus on the relationship between Canaanites, Philistines, and Israelites in the Land of Israel during the Bronze and Iron Ages.
